What's Happening?
NPR kicks off the fifth edition of its 'El Tiny' concert series, celebrating Latin music from September 15 to October 15. The series features a diverse lineup of artists, including Fito Páez, Carlos Vives, and Gloria Estefan, showcasing various Latin music genres. 'El Tiny' aims to connect generations and highlight the richness of Latin culture. The concerts will be available on NPR Music's YouTube channel, accompanied by exclusive content.
